In Kerala, the scriptwriter has historically enjoyed a status equal to or greater than the director. Figures like M.T. Vasudevan Nair transitioned into cinema, ensuring that dialogue remained poetic yet grounded, and that narratives focused heavily on character psychology over superficial action. As it moves forward, Malayalam cinema stands at an exciting crossroads. The global acclaim has opened new markets and creative possibilities. However, the industry also faces the critical challenge of addressing its historical exclusions, particularly regarding caste and access. The brilliant critical and commercial success of recent years has created a virtuous cycle, attracting new talent and investment while raising the bar for storytelling.
